AP US History Chapter 4 Terms Flashcards

Terms : Hide Images
4893040176Tenancy-To rent land0
4893056616Competency-Ability for a family to keep their household independent through future generations1
4893100939Household Mode of Production-Practice where families traded labor and goods -Helped New-England free holders survive on small farms2
4893110075Squatters-People who illegally settle on land they do not own -Hoped to acquire it on legal terms3
4893115931Redemptioner-Indentured servants that formed contracts after arriving in America -Families had increased flexibility with contract terms4
4893124629Enlightenment-Cultural movement in Europe -Used reason to reevaluate previous doctrines that were accepted in society -Caused people to think more logically and rationally5
4893140398Pietism-Evangelical Christian movement -Emphasized Bible study -Emphasized individual relationship with God -One of two biggest cultural movements in Europe6
4893157238Natural Rights-Rights that all people are entitled to -Life, liberty, property7
4893168965Deism-Belief that God created the universe then left it to run using natural laws -Adopted by small number of urban artisans, wealthy virginia planters, and seaport merchants -Was not an established religion8
4893181361Revival-Renewal of enthusiasm in Christian beliefs9
4893187405Old Lights-Conservative ministers who opposed the enthusiasm displayed by evangelical preachers10
4893194949New Lights-Evangelical preachers who believed that Christian faith was intellectual and emphasized spiritual rebirth -Allowed women to speak in public11
4893206920Consumer Revolution-Increase in consumption of manufactured goods -Raised living standards -Landed many consumers and colonies in debt -Increase in transatlantic trade made Americans more dependent on overseas credit and markets12
4893218901Regulators-Landowning protesters -Demanded the government provide western colonies with more courts, fairer taxation, and greater representation in the assembly -Ultimately failed to seize power from eastern elites13
